Default recommendations for replacement air filter?

hi folks. yes i did a search, but all i could gather were posts on full intake systems

we bought a 99 gs400 that came with an hks intake system, and it kept throwing CELs. after finding out how much it would cost to dyno tune with an apexi safc i chose to reinstall the airbox with it's dingy original filter, which is hurting performance.

i was wondering if there are aftermarket options to a stock panel filter, or should i stay with stock? i do not want to use k&n because of the oil messing up sensors over time. i know i know... use oil sparingly, but after so many times on different cars i has cost me and i don't want to do it anymore.

i tried searching on the net but could only come up with a few names...

- trd
- tom's
- apexi
- blitz

does ne1 have any input on how these perform? which ones are dry filters? paper or foam? disposable or reusable? price?

thanks in advance...

i've done a search already which is why i posted this thread to begin with... i haven't had much luck.

according to the k&n website:

- k&n part number for gs400 is 33-2137
- oem toyota part number is 1780150030

but i cannot find listing for the gs430... is this the part number for what u have?
